What Are Polyurethane Coatings?
Polyurethane coatings are formulated by reacting polyols with isocyanates to form a cross‑linked polymer network. This chemistry yields films that combine toughness, chemical resistance, and optical clarity. The ability to adjust formulation parameters—such as hardness, gloss, and curing time—enables manufacturers to produce coatings that meet specific performance criteria, from solvent‑based systems for high‑speed industrial lines to water‑borne variants that comply with stringent environmental standards.

Future Trends
Market Drivers
Automotive manufacturers are increasingly specifying polyurethane topcoats to meet durability and weight targets, while construction projects demand long‑lasting, low‑emission finishes that comply with tightening VOC regulations. The electrification of transport further drives demand for coatings that protect battery enclosures and charging infrastructure.
Challenges
Regulatory tightening on VOCs and the volatility of key raw materials such as isocyanates and polyols impose cost pressures. Additionally, the need for skilled applicators and advanced equipment can slow deployment in smaller enterprises.
Opportunities
Smart coating solutions—self‑healing, anti‑corrosion, and nanofiller‑enhanced formulations—open new revenue streams in high‑value sectors like offshore platforms and renewable energy. End‑of‑life recycling initiatives also provide a sustainability narrative that can differentiate brands in a market increasingly driven by ESG criteria.
Competitive Landscape
The market is dominated by a handful of multinational players whose combined share exceeds 50% of global volume. Their capacity to invest in R&D, expand low‑VOC portfolios, and maintain robust supply chains creates high entry barriers for smaller competitors.
